Tethered Drones Market Analysis
One of the primary defense applications of tethered drones is persistent intelligence, surveillance, and reconnaissance (ISR). Unlike battery-powered drones, tethered drones can remain airborne for extended periods—hours, days, or even weeks—owing to their continuous power supply via a tether. This endurance allows military forces to maintain constant situational awareness over sensitive areas such as borders, checkpoints, and conflict zones without interruption. Equipped with advanced ISR payloads, including high-resolution cameras, thermal imaging, and radar sensors, tethered drones provide real-time, high-quality intelligence to commanders on the ground.
Tethered Drones Market Overview:
A tethered drone is an unmanned aerial vehicle (UAV) that is primarily connected to a ground station via a tether—a cable or wire that supplies continuous power and enables secure communication between the drone and the operator. Unlike conventional free-flying drones that rely on onboard batteries, tethered drones receive power directly from the ground station, allowing them to stay airborne for extended periods, often several hours or even days. The tether also offers a stable data link, reducing the risk of signal loss or hacking. Typically, tethered drones are rotary-wing systems capable of vertical takeoff, hovering, and precise positioning within the limited range defined by the tether length, which usually supports operational altitudes up to around 120–200 meters, depending on the system design.

Development of Tethered Drones for Commercial Applications:
Tethered drones are integrated into autonomous vessels and port security systems for real-time detection of underwater threats, monitoring hulls, and securing shipping routes. The SMAUG project in Europe demonstrates how combined sensors (hydrophones, sonar, drones) create a multi-layered maritime security solution. Tethered drones are favored in environments with strict drone regulations, as their tethered nature increases operational safety, predictability, and restricts flight area, reducing concerns over airspace congestion or privacy violations.

Tethered drones face challenges such as added weight and drag from the tether cable, limiting flight range and maneuverability. Managing the tether safely in complex environments is difficult, and environmental factors like wind can affect stability. Payload capacity is restricted by power and weight limits. Regulatory constraints, safety concerns, high costs, and security vulnerabilities hinder wider adoption and operational flexibility.

The rotary wing dominated the market. Unlike fixed-wing or hybrid drones, they do not need forward motion to stay airborne, making them well-suited for persistent monitoring from a fixed location.
